
PELICAN RAPIDS, Minn. (KWAD) — The Birchwood Golf Course turned into a festival of fall running on Thursday, Sept. 25, as the Glenn Moerke Invitational brought together varsity squads from across the region. In perfect cool-and-crisp conditions, Barnesville’s girls dominated wire-to-wire, while Lake Park-Audubon’s boys packed a decisive win. Host Pelican Rapids thrilled home fans with podium finishes on both sides.
The Barnesville girls delivered a rare and emphatic perfect 15-point team score, capturing the top seven places and stamping their name on the meet’s history. Eighth-grader Cassidy Rotz ran away from the field with a winning time of 20:54.7, setting the tone early. Teammates Sienna Marshall (22:05.2) and Jovie Marshall (22:18.2) locked up second and third. Rory Guderjahn (4th, 22:33.4) and Carly Orvik (5th, 22:35.9) rounded out the official scoring five, while Liv Schmitz (6th, 22:38.7) and Braelyn Bomstad (7th, 23:03.4) gave the Trojans unmatched depth.
Behind Barnesville, Nevis (56 points) used a late surge to edge Pelican Rapids (69) for runner-up honors. Nevis was led by Taylor Monroe (13th, 25:18.1), Miranda Kowalke (14th, 25:20.2) and Kristen Sandmeyer (15th, 26:20), while the host Vikings were paced by Megan Guler’s 23:22.6 ninth-place finish and steady efforts from Aleeya Stringer Ferris (18th, 26:41.5) and Jordan Batson (20th, 29:24.7).
The Lake Park-Audubon boys made every place count, scoring 26 points to earn team gold with a tight scoring pack and a team average of 20:22.1. Hunter Harman, a senior, was brilliant up front, winning the race in 19:00.5 with a decisive move in the final mile. Sophomore Caleb Houle (4th, 20:09.6), Samuel Strom (6th, 20:16.1) and Tydan Eiter (8th, 20:29.8) formed a near-simultaneous wall at the finish. Haven Howrey (11th, 21:53.9) sealed the scoring five, giving the Raiders a 1-4-6-8-11 scoring split that no other team could match.
Pelican Rapids grabbed second place with 46 points. Senior Andrew Checco de Souza led the way in 19:37.1 for third, with Teo Thompson (8th, 20:40.5) and Jadon Peterson (9th, 20:41.3) adding key single-digit finishes. Barnesville (53) and Nevis (92) placed third and fourth.
